Key Features Comparison

Pianoteq
Pianoteq Features
  • Physical modeling of piano and other keyboard instruments for realistic sound
  • Customizable parameters like piano type, tuning, string resonance, lid position etc
  • VST, AU and AAX plugin versions available
  • Standalone version available
  • Note-by-note editing
  • Playback of MIDI files
  • Over 50 instrument models available including pianos, electric pianos, harpsichords, organs, celestas etc

Pros & Cons Analysis

Pianoteq
Pianoteq

Pros

  • Very realistic and expressive sound
  • Low CPU usage
  • Customizable to suit personal preferences
  • Available as plugin and standalone application

Cons

  • Limited number of effects/sound design options
  • Expensive compared to sample libraries
  • Limited articulations/playing styles
